[0001] This utility model belongs to the field of bentonite processing technology, specifically relating to a bentonite drying and spreading device. Background Technology

[0002] Bentonite is a non-metallic mineral with montmorillonite as its main mineral component. It is widely used in agriculture and industry and is therefore known as "universal clay". After mining or processing, bentonite often has a high water content and needs to be dried to reduce the water content in order to meet the requirements of subsequent processing or use.

[0003] Existing drying and spreading devices often suffer from uneven drying and clumping of bentonite at the bottom when spreading thicker layers, resulting in low drying efficiency and inconsistent quality. [0030] like Figure 1-6As shown, a bentonite drying and spreading device includes a mobile telescopic frame and a drive assembly. The top of the mobile telescopic frame is provided with a support frame 2. Multiple rotating rods 3 are rotatably connected between the support frame 2 and the mobile telescopic frame. One end of the rotating rod 3 passes through the upper end of the mobile telescopic frame and is provided with a spreading assembly. The spreading assembly includes a connecting rod 4 and a multi-layer turning and drying component on the connecting rod 4. The drive assembly is located between the mobile telescopic frame and the support frame 2 and is used to drive the rotating rods 3 to rotate, thereby realizing the rotation of the spreading assembly. In use, the mobile telescopic frame is moved to a suitable position, and then the telescopic support frame 2 drives the spreading assembly to descend and gradually penetrate into the bentonite. Then, the drive assembly drives the multiple rotating rods 3 to rotate simultaneously. The rotating rods 3 drive the connecting rod 4 and the multi-layer turning and drying component to rotate. While rotating, the bentonite at different depths is turned and the clumps of bentonite are broken up. Then, the mobile telescopic frame is pulled to move, and a large area of ​​bentonite is turned and spread.

[0031] Furthermore, each layer of the drying unit includes multiple spreading teeth 5 equidistantly arranged on the outer wall of the connecting rod 4. The angle between the spreading teeth 5 and the connecting rod 4 gradually decreases from the upper layer to the lower layer, and the curvature of the spreading teeth 5 gradually increases from the upper layer to the lower layer. During use, the connecting rod 4 rotates, causing the multiple spreading teeth 5 to rotate. During the process of stirring and mixing the bentonite, the multiple spreading teeth 5 can also break up the clumps of bentonite, similar to a stirring rod. The angle between the spreading teeth 5 and the connecting rod 4 gradually decreases from the upper layer to the lower layer, which makes it easier for the spreading teeth 5 to penetrate into the bentonite. One end of the spreading teeth 5 located at the bottom layer can be set to a sharper state, which makes it easier to penetrate into the bentonite. Due to the gradual increase in curvature of the spreading teeth 5 from the upper layer to the lower layer and the rotational movement, the bentonite is squeezed and loosened in the vertical direction while being turned horizontally, which promotes air circulation and moisture evaporation between the bentonite particles, thereby better completing the drying process.

[0032] Furthermore, the drive assembly includes multiple meshing gears 601 and a motor 602 mounted on the support frame 2. The middle part of the gears 601 is connected to the rotating rods 3. One end of one of the rotating rods 3 extends to the outside of the support frame 2 and is connected to the output end of the motor 602. In use, the motor 602 drives the rotating rods 3 to rotate, the rotating rods 3 drive the gears 601 to rotate, and the remaining gears 601 mesh and rotate, driving multiple sets of paving components to rotate. During the rotation, since the rotation directions of the gears 601 are opposite, the rotation directions of two adjacent sets of paving components are also opposite. Therefore, the mixing efficiency of bentonite is higher during the mixing process of the paving teeth 5.

[0033] Furthermore, the bottom of the rotating rod 3 is fitted onto the upper end of the connecting rod 4. A fixing pin 7 is movably connected between the rotating rod 3 and the connecting rod 4. One end of the fixing pin 7 is threadedly connected to a limit cap 8. In use, one end of the connecting rod 4 is fitted onto the bottom of the rotating rod 3, and then the fixing pin 7 passes through the connecting rod 4 and the rotating rod 3. The fixing pin 7 is fixed by tightening the limit cap 8. When it is necessary to repair or replace the paving component, or to increase or decrease the number of paving components as needed, the fixing pin 7 can be removed by unscrewing the limit cap 8, thereby disassembling the paving component.

[0034] Furthermore, the paving teeth 5 are provided with multiple disturbance parts 9. The multiple disturbance parts 9 can increase the disturbance force on the bentonite and the breaking up of agglomerates during the rotation of the paving teeth 5, thereby improving the paving efficiency.

[0035] Furthermore, the mobile telescopic frame includes a top frame 101, a bottom frame 102, a telescopic component 103 located between the top frame 101 and the bottom frame 102, and multiple moving wheels 104 rotatably connected to the bottom frame 102. The bottom frame 102 is provided with a push handle 10. The telescopic component 103 can be an electric telescopic rod, a hydraulic telescopic rod, etc. By pushing the bottom frame 102 with the handle, the entire telescopic mobile frame can be moved. When it moves to the position where mixing is required, the telescopic component 103 causes the top frame 101 to descend, thereby allowing the paving components to contact the bentonite, making it convenient to use.

[0036] The working principle and usage process of this utility model are as follows: When using this equipment, firstly, install an appropriate number of paving components as needed. Then, place the upper end of the connecting rod 4 onto the rotating rod 3, pass it through the fixing pin 7, and thread an upper limit cap 8 onto one end of the fixing pin 7 for fixation. Next, hold the push handle 10 to move the telescopic support frame 2 to the appropriate position. Then, the telescopic component 103 drives the top frame 101 to descend, thereby driving the rotating rod 3 and the paving components to descend as a whole. Simultaneously, start the motor 602. The motor 602 drives one of the rotating rods 3 to rotate, and the rotating rod 3 drives one of the gears 601 to rotate. Then, multiple gears 601 mesh and rotate together, driving multiple paving components to rotate. During the rotation of the paving components, the paving teeth 5 penetrate deep into the bentonite while breaking up any clumps in the bentonite. Simultaneously, the disturbance part 9 assists the paving teeth 5 in breaking up the clumps. Then, hold the push handle 10 to gradually spread the bentonite in different locations. During the paving and drying process, the uniformity of drying is improved, and clumps of bentonite are broken up, improving drying efficiency and quality.
